Heather Gray for a Job Interview
Heather Gray works for interviews when you want to show up polished without broadcasting nerves or trying too hard. Pair it with Burgundy or Cobalt Blue to add just enough presence and authority while keeping the focus on what you're saying. Because it's neutral, Heather Gray anchors bolder accents without looking like you're performing confidence instead of having it.
